True Facts about episode 20: Just Do It

  1. This episode is loosely inspired by a story Producer Jasmine once told me from her high school days. It’s also shot in her childhood bedroom, so the scene is literally taking place in the same location.
  2. MK’s face was super red from all the making out. I think we had to put on extra foundation afterwards.
  3. On the final take, David almost made me spit my coffee out, it was so funny.
  4. The table they’re sitting at at lunch is the same one from Cougarville.
  5. The final scene was originally conceived for the trailer, but it didn’t fit in this episode, so we re-shot it a year later.
  6. The original line was “Sid loved Nancy” and not “Apollo loved Starbuck”, and we knew that Zelda wouldn’t care about the Sex Pistols. It was Nick Thurkettle who came up with the BSG reference on set that day.
  7. We add a dog barking in the background of Zelda’s bedroom scenes consistently to set tone and locale. I like to imagine it’s Percy’s dog Copernicus, sensing an intruder from blocks away.
